Movie Night at the Crocker

For anyone interested in Mid Century Modern architecture this is a must see. Julius Shulman photographed some of the best architecture of his time. His work brought modern design to the masses via countless media publications. An amazing artist of his trade, he captured the essence of these architectural icons through his lens.

This is part of The Crockers "Thursdays 'til 9" series. It's a great opportunity to check out the exhibits (price of the ticket includes admission to the museum) and grab a bite to eat at the cafe before going to the event. They have a wide variety of events from lectures to movies to concerts. Last Thursday I saw a local musician (Kate Gaffney) in concert there. The acoustics were great... so great that they dropped the mics and amplifiers and just played acoustic.
